Chapter XIV · Śloka 27
ब्रह्मणो हि प्रतिष्ठाहममृतस्याव्ययस्य च ।
शाश्वतस्य च धर्मस्य सुखस्यैकान्तिकस्य च ॥
brahmaṇo hi pratiṣṭhāham amṛtasyāvyayasya ca |
śāśvatasya ca dharmasya sukhasyaikāntikasya ca ||
For I am the foundation of Brahman — of the immortal and imperishable, of the eternal dharma, and of absolute bliss.
The chapter closes with the ultimate declaration: the personal Lord (Kṛṣṇa) is the very ground and support of the impersonal Absolute (Brahman), of immortality, of eternal righteousness, and of the unqualified bliss that is the final goal of all existence.
